How to Plan a Self-Driving Tour from Beijing to Tibet? A Step-by-Step Guide

Traveling from Beijing to Tibet by car is a dream for many adventurers. However, the journey is not only long but also filled with challenges such as high altitudes, unpredictable weather, and complex road conditions. This guide will provide you with a clear and practical solution to plan your self-driving tour from Beijing to Tibet, ensuring a safe and unforgettable experience.
Starting your self-driving tour from Beijing to Tibet requires careful preparation. The first thing you need to do is understand the route and the necessary permits. The journey typically takes around 4 to 5 days, covering a distance of approximately 2,000 kilometers. The main route includes the G6 expressway, the G3014 highway, and the S3012 highway. It is important to check the latest road conditions and traffic updates before starting your trip. Additionally, you must obtain a Tibet Travel Permit, which is required for all foreign visitors entering Tibet. This permit can be applied for online through the official website of the Tibet Tourism Bureau or through a local travel agency.
Another important consideration is the vehicle you choose. A four-wheel drive vehicle is highly recommended due to the rugged terrain and unpredictable weather conditions. Ensure that your car is well-maintained and equipped with necessary tools such as a spare tire, jumper cables, and a first-aid kit. It is also advisable to carry enough fuel, as gas stations along the route can be sparse and sometimes closed for maintenance.
The journey from Beijing to Tibet involves crossing through several regions with varying altitudes. The altitude increases gradually, and it is crucial to acclimatize properly to avoid altitude sickness. It is recommended to spend a day or two in Lhasa, the capital of Tibet, to allow your body to adjust to the high altitude. During this time, you can visit the Potala Palace, Jokhang Temple, and other iconic landmarks. It is also a good idea to consult with a local guide to get the most out of your visit.
When planning your itinerary, it is important to take into account the best times to visit certain regions. For example, the best time to visit the Everest region is during the spring or autumn seasons when the weather is more favorable. Similarly, the best time to visit the Yarlung Tsangpo Grand Canyon is during the summer months when the water levels are higher and the scenery is more dramatic. By planning your itinerary around these seasonal factors, you can ensure a more enjoyable and comfortable travel experience.
One of the most important aspects of a self-driving tour in Tibet is the need for flexibility. Road conditions can change rapidly, and unexpected delays are common. It is advisable to have a backup plan in case of road closures or weather-related disruptions. Additionally, it is important to respect local customs and traditions, as Tibet is a culturally rich and diverse region. Always ask for permission before taking photographs of local people, and be mindful of the local environment.
